Graduate in IT Reliability Mathematics

IT Reliability Mathematics is a field of study that focuses on reliability and its application in the IT industry.

It deals with the mathematical modeling and analysis of complex systems to ensure high levels of reliability and availability in IT systems.

Graduates in IT Reliability Mathematics are equipped to design and develop reliable systems, identify and mitigate potential failures, and optimize system performance.

They can work in various roles such as system engineer, quality assurance engineer, or reliability engineer in industries like finance, healthcare, and telecommunications.

Learn key facts about Graduate in IT Reliability Mathematics

The Graduate in IT Reliability Mathematics is a postgraduate program that focuses on the application of mathematical techniques to ensure the reliability and maintainability of complex IT systems.
This program is designed to equip students with the necessary skills and knowledge to analyze and solve problems in the field of IT reliability,
emphasizing the use of mathematical models and statistical techniques to optimize system performance and minimize downtime.
Upon completion of the program, graduates will have a deep understanding of the mathematical principles underlying IT reliability,
as well as the ability to apply these principles to real-world problems in the IT industry.
The program is typically completed over a period of one to two years, depending on the institution and the student's background.
Throughout the program, students will engage in hands-on learning, working on projects and case studies that illustrate the application of mathematical techniques to IT reliability.
The Graduate in IT Reliability Mathematics is highly relevant to the IT industry, where the ability to ensure the reliability and maintainability of complex systems is critical.
